    Hey Guys,

    I brought back my ASUS-G73JH, because I was reading about all the issues it had, and the keyboard lag was seriously bugging me. I returned it without a problem to BestBuy. My question to you guys is, should I go back to the store and buy it again? Are there any ASUS updates that will make it more stable?

    Are there any future ASUS gaming laptops expected? It's a lot of money, so I want to make the right decision. Any other brands that come close to ASUS?

    Thank you so much

    Dont buy the bestbuy version as the screen sucks. If you can wait the G73JW is coming out, and althought it has a lesser nVidia card (460M vs HD5870) it will have better drivers (presumably). Also the G73JH-B1 is out with a slightly more powerful processor. Asus is (supposedly) working on drivers that, well, work.

    I have the BB version with LG screen, it looks great to me. If you don't need the extra resolution, then the 1600x900 screen is fine. I play all my games at this resolution anyway. Aside from this, minus 2 GB of unnecessary memory, and lack of bluetooth, the RBBX05 is exactly the same machine as the Ax or Xx.

    And my RBBX05 doesn't GSOD, so that's a definite plus.
